a commercial project requires the installation of 1,856 sq ft of acoustical ceiling.
using a productivity rate of 0.013 labor hours per square foot and a productivity
factor of 0.95, determine the number of labor hours required to install the ceiling
- answer-labor hours = 1856 sq ft x 0.013 hr/sq ft = 24.128
adjusted labor hours = 24.128 x 0.95 = 22.9
a commercial project requires the installation of 127 square yards of carpet. using a
productivity rate of 0.108 labor hours per square yard and a productivity factor of
1.05, determine the number of labor hours required to install the carpet
- answer-labor hours = 127 sq yds x 0.108 hr/sq yd = 13.716
adjusted labor hours = 13.716 x 1.05 = 14.4
